excel表格怎么弄单数行高

excel表格怎么弄单数行高

Excel表格单数行高设置:使用条件格式、应用VBA代码、手动调整

在Excel中设置单数行高可以帮助提升数据的可读性和表格的美观度。条件格式应用VBA代码手动调整是实现这一目标的主要方法。条件格式可以快速应用颜色或格式来区分单数行和偶数行,但无法直接调整行高;应用VBA代码则是通过编程实现精细化的控制;手动调整则适用于小规模的表格调整。

以下详细描述如何使用VBA代码来调整单数行高:

一、条件格式

条件格式是Excel中非常强大的功能,可以用来高亮显示数据、设置单数行的颜色等,但它不能直接调整行高。

二、应用VBA代码

VBA(Visual Basic for Applications)是Excel中用于编程的语言。通过编写VBA代码,我们可以精确地控制单数行的行高。

1. 开启开发者工具

首先,确保Excel中的“开发工具”选项卡可见。若不可见,需在Excel选项中启用。

2. 编写VBA代码

打开开发工具,点击“Visual Basic”按钮,插入一个新的模块,并输入以下代码:

Sub SetOddRowsHeight()

Dim i As Integer

Dim lastRow As Long

' 获取最后一行的行号

lastRow = Cells(Rows.Count, 1).End(xlUp).Row

' 循环遍历所有行

For i = 1 To lastRow

' 判断是否为单数行

If i Mod 2 = 1 Then

' 设置行高,假设这里设置为20

Rows(i).RowHeight = 20

End If

Next i

End Sub

3. 运行代码

返回Excel工作表,按下 Alt + F8,选择 SetOddRowsHeight,点击“运行”。此时,所有单数行的行高将被调整为20。

三、手动调整

如果你的表格规模较小,可以考虑手动调整单数行的行高。

1. 选择单数行

按住 Ctrl 键,逐一选择单数行。

2. 调整行高

右键点击选中的行,选择“行高”,然后输入你希望的行高值,点击“确定”。

四、使用宏录制

如果你不熟悉VBA编程,但需要重复进行单数行高的调整,可以使用Excel的宏录制功能来简化操作。

1. 录制宏

在“开发工具”选项卡下,点击“录制宏”,命名宏并选择存储位置。

2. 执行操作

在录制宏的过程中,手动选择并调整单数行的行高。

3. 停止录制

完成操作后,点击“停止录制”。

4. 运行宏

以后需要调整单数行高时,只需运行录制的宏即可。

五、使用第三方插件

市面上有一些Excel插件可以提供更丰富的表格管理功能,包括行高调整。可以根据实际需求进行选择和使用。

六、注意事项

  1. 兼容性:确保使用的VBA代码或插件与当前Excel版本兼容。
  2. 备份数据:进行大规模操作前,建议备份表格数据,防止误操作导致数据丢失。
  3. 性能影响:大规模数据调整可能会影响Excel的性能,建议分批进行调整。
  4. 灵活性:根据实际需求选择合适的方法,VBA编程适用于复杂需求,手动调整适用于简单需求。

总结

通过上述方法,可以灵活地调整Excel表格中单数行的行高。条件格式虽然不能直接调整行高,但可用于其他格式化需求;VBA代码提供了强大的编程能力,可以精细控制行高;手动调整适用于小规模操作,方便快捷。根据实际需求选择合适的方法,能够有效提升表格的美观度和可读性。

相关问答FAQs:

1. 如何在Excel表格中设置单数行的高度?

  • 在Excel中,您可以通过以下步骤设置单数行的高度:
    • 首先,选择您想要调整行高的单数行。您可以通过单击行号来选择整行,或者按住鼠标左键并拖动以选择多行。
    • 其次,右键单击选定的行号,然后在弹出菜单中选择“行高”选项。
    • 在弹出的对话框中,输入您想要设置的行高数值,然后点击“确定”按钮。
    • 最后,您将看到所选单数行的高度已被相应调整。

2. 如何在Excel中调整特定行的高度,而不影响其他行?

  • 您可以按照以下步骤在Excel中调整特定行的高度,而不会影响其他行的高度:
    • 首先,选择您要调整高度的行。按住Ctrl键并单击行号,以选择多个非连续的行;或者按住Shift键并单击行号,以选择连续的多行。
    • 其次,右键单击选定的行号,然后选择“行高”选项。
    • 在弹出的对话框中,输入您想要设置的行高数值,然后点击“确定”按钮。
    • 最后,您将看到所选行的高度已被相应调整,而其他行的高度保持不变。

3. 如何在Excel中设置交替行的高度以增强可读性?

  • 您可以通过以下步骤在Excel中设置交替行的高度,以增强数据的可读性:
    • 首先,选择您想要设置交替行高度的区域。按住鼠标左键并拖动以选择多行。
    • 其次,右键单击选定的行号,然后选择“条件格式化”选项。
    • 在弹出的对话框中,选择“新建规则”。
    • 在选择规则类型的列表中,选择“使用公式确定要设置的格式”选项。
    • 在“格式值”框中输入公式,例如“=MOD(ROW(),2)=1”,然后点击“确定”按钮。
    • 最后,您将看到交替行的高度已被设置为不同的数值,从而提高了数据的可读性。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4294752

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部